    The fact is it would be in SE's interests to give players a legitimate means to either sell houses directly to other players or get the relinquished 80% value back at will (not after 45 days). They need to encourage players to give up plots they don't want, and imposing tighter and tighter restrictions on players relinquishing their plots is only going to make the shortage WORSE as they will not willingly give up a plot only to lose the huge investment they put into it.

    SE's flip-flopping stance on the issue really hasn't helped either as they have been directly quoted as saying this was fine back when housing first released. They only turned into a crime after they screwed up the auto-demolish so badly and the same people bought every house just to resell them. They SHOULD have put an account limit of one house prior to the demolition.

    There is nothing greedy about refusing to give up a plot you saved up to buy when you stand only to lose your gil by doing so. A lot of the people selling their plots legitimately want rid of it for one of any number of good reasons. To give you just a few, they may be: transferring servers, moving house, leaving the game for longer than three months (the auto-reclaimed gil only sits for one month so if you know you'll be gone longer you HAVE to sell it). In these cases the players selling the plot do not WANT to price gouge other players, they simply want to get back the gil they invested. You cannot blame people for that.
